1. What is Acute Small Bowel Obstruction?
Acute small bowel obstruction refers to a sudden blockage of the small intestine, which could stem from various factors ranging from adhesions, hernias, and neoplasms to inflammatory diseases. Immediate recognition and intervention are crucial, as untreated ASBO can lead to severe complications, including intestinal ischemia and perforation.
2. Causes of Acute Small Bowel Obstruction
Key causes include:
- Adhesions: Scar tissue from prior surgeries.
- Hernias: Portions of the intestine becoming trapped outside their normal position.
- Tumors: Both benign and malignant growths.
- Inflammation: Conditions like Crohn’s disease.
Understanding the cause is essential for developing an effective treatment plan.
3. Traditional Treatment Approaches
3.1 Open Surgery
Historically, open surgery has been the standard treatment for ASBO. This involves a large incision in the abdominal wall to access the intestine directly.
3.2 Limitations of Open Surgery
While effective, open surgery is associated with risks such as:
- Longer recovery times.
- Greater postoperative pain.
- Increased risk of infection and complications.
4. Understanding Celioscopic Techniques
4.1 What is Celioscopy?
Celioscopy, commonly referred to as laparoscopy, is a minimally invasive surgical technique that employs small incisions and specialized instruments, including a camera, to navigate the abdominal cavity.

6. Navigating Acute Small Bowel Obstructions with Celioscopy
6.1 Diagnostic Techniques
Celioscopic techniques can also facilitate accurate diagnosis. Surgeons can visualize the bowel directly, allowing for immediate assessment and intervention.
6.2 Surgical Approaches
Surgeons can employ various celioscopic methods, including:
- Laparoscopic Adhesiolysis: Removing adhesions constraining the intestine.
- Laparoscopic Resection: Resection of a segment of the bowel in cases of malignancy or severe ischemia.
